Prepare For Your Job Search

As we always like to express, different countries have different rules when it comes to CV writing and the application process. It’s important to research this before applying for any jobs in Portugal to ensure that your CV, cover letter and your general job search approach is up to the Portuguese standards.

Portugal’s CV structure differs from other European countries in terms of length and structure, they tend to be less strict when it comes to the length of your CV. Accepting around 1-3 pages, unlike other European countries who usually have a strict limit of 2 pages in length.

Move to Portugal 

Hopefully, you already feel persuaded and encouraged to search for jobs in Portugal. To ensure that your move to Portugal is smooth and drama-free we have some useful tips to ensure that you are organised and ready to take on Portugal! 

  • Meet People - Nowadays its easier than ever before to meet people before we relocate somewhere as well as when we arrive. Of course, you may meet lots of people through your job in Portugal but it’s nice to branch out and make a wider circle of friends too, you can meet people with the same interests as you and try out new activities, it’s a great way to settle into a new location. Websites like Meetup.comInternationsCouchsurfing are great places to connect with fellow expatriates and surrounding yourself with people like you will make your move considerably easier! 

  • Find somewhere to live -  Now for one of the hardest parts, trying to find housing, it can be difficult to find somewhere to live, especially if you are trying to do it from another country but our best advice to stay in a hostel for your first few days, and during this time you can book some house and flat viewings. This gives you the opportunity to go and look around the different areas of the city and see where exactly you want to live. 

  • Sort our your finances - Our best advice is to set yourself up with an online bank account before you relocate. These type of bank accounts are perfect for travellers and will help you to avoid paying any unwanted fees. As you are looking for jobs in Portugal, these are the perfect bank accounts for you, as you can get paid straight into this account.
